Corned Beef Hash

Whether using canned hash or leftover brisket and potatoes, the air fryer is the ultimate tool for this dish. It dries out the excess moisture and creates those glorious, crispy bits everyone fights over. It is a smashing success for any hearty morning appetite.

  1. Preheat air fryer to 400 degrees F.
  2. Crumble or chop the corned beef hash into small, even pieces.
  3. Spread the hash in a single layer at the bottom of the air fryer basket.
  4. Spray lightly with cooking oil to encourage browning.
  5. Cook for 6 minutes, then use a spatula to flip and stir the hash.
  6. Cook for another 4 to 6 minutes until deeply browned and crispy.
  7. Serve immediately while hot and crunchy.
